[QUOTE="ranger, post: 322140, member: 40555"] I was just going on past results. Wales don't play in NZ very often so people seem to forget, but the last three homes games NZ played against Wales ended 52-3, 54-9, and 55-3. Also, in the last 5 years of games against Wales in Cardiff, they have only managed 1 try. I think that a lot of the early season rust was coughed up during the last game and the ABs should really start clicking. The holes that NZ started leaving against Ireland wont necessarily be there anymore after another week training together. I predict a slaughter. Also, If you haven't heard alot about Cory Jane, then you're in for a bit of a shock. He is by far and away the best outside back in NZ. Hes world class and would be among the top Fullbacks/Wings in the world based on his last few years. Beats the first defender every time he touches the ball, he runs great angles and has an insane handoff for a little guy [/QUOTE]
